Geneva Conventions — 60th Anniversary

Wed, August 12th, 2009 was the 60th anniversary of the signing of the Geneva Conventions. A landmark in international humanitarian law, these series of treaties, have been the basis for the law of armed conflict in the 20th (post-WW II) … Continue reading
